Fresh Cheese Making Class with Urbana Chef John Critchley
Guests will make their own cheeses, sample wine, cheese and charcuterie

What: Executive Chef John Critchley, who has created his own in-house cheeses at Urbana, will lead a class on how to make fresh fromage blanc, mozzarella and haloumi. The class will be held at the pizza bar and will include an interactive lesson during which guests will make their own fromage blanc, mozzarella and haloumi cheeses from scratch. Chef Critchley will engage participants in a discussion on cheese making while guests nibble on cheese and charcuterie and enjoy samples of wine. Guests will also be able to take home recipe cards so they can prepare fresh cheeses at home, as well as honey and marmalades to pair with their cheese. This is the first in a series of classes by Chef Critchley that will highlight the various techniques he employs at the restaurant. Forthcoming classes will include a lamb cooking demo in partnership with Border Springs Lamb (April 21) and a demo on chef’s favorite cocktails in partnership with lead bartender Obi Emenyonu (June 9th). In the fall, classes will continue with a knife skills demonstration, and oyster selection, shucking and cooking class in the winter.
